Transaction 51fc3bd95b3e0ca33460adeb2a57b994c35ce091e6a8bed24c5a3f1c32fa64a6
1 Input
1 Output
-
51fc3bd95b3e0ca33460adeb2a57b994c35ce091e6a8bed24c5a3f1c32fa64a6:0
- value
- 506415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 391d71b44c8ee27142dd611b135c5e69bf6b321b OP_EQUAL
- address
- 36u1iJ1JN3cszNGb7HCgPhhgz7BsEGhJqe